Hamilton Thorne (CVE:HTL) Stock Price Passes Above 50-Day Moving Average – Time to Sell?

Shares of Hamilton Thorne Ltd. (CVE:HTLGet Free Report) crossed above its fifty day moving average during trading on Monday . The stock has a fifty day moving average of C$1.45 and traded as high as C$1.45. Hamilton Thorne shares last traded at C$1.45, with a volume of 25,700 shares.

Hamilton Thorne Price Performance

The company has a quick ratio of 2.25, a current ratio of 2.04 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 43.24. The company has a market cap of C$149.69 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 58.94 and a beta of 0.54. The company has a fifty day simple moving average of C$1.45 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of C$1.45.

Hamilton Thorne Ltd. develops, manufactures, and sells precision instruments, consumables, software, and services for the assisted reproductive technologies (ART), research, and cell biology markets. It offers precision laser systems, imaging systems, and other equipment and consumables for the ART and developmental biology research markets. The company also provides test laboratory and endotoxin testing services, as well as sperm assays, including Sperm Motility Index and Sperm Penetration; and fresh and cryopreserved mouse embryos supply, and technician training and proficiency testing services.
